Growing the Canopy: Bringing Career-Connected Charter Schools into the National Conversation

Across the country, there are extraordinarily exciting things happening inside many charter schools. Students designing aircraft components alongside engineers. High schoolers logging hours in real medical clinics or veterinary labs. Welding students fabricating parts that will actually be used by local manufacturers. Future teachers leading lessons in elementary classrooms while still in high school. Others…

Student Career & Workforce Planning Map

From Industry Need → Student Opportunity → Action  Strong student career pathways are built when workforce needs are clearly defined, student experiences are intentionally designed, and partnerships are purposefully activated. Use this simple map to begin brainstorming how workforce needs connect to student opportunities. It helps you quickly surface gaps, identify partners, and start shaping next steps—ideas…
